sql数据库已断开什么意思

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    当说SQL数据库已断开时,意味着数据库与应用程序或客户端之间的连接已经中断或丢失。这可能是由于以下几个原因导致的:

    1. 网络问题:数据库服务器和应用程序之间的网络连接中断可能是导致数据库断开的常见原因之一。这可能是由于网络故障、防火墙设置、网络拥塞等原因导致的。在这种情况下,需要检查网络连接是否正常,并确保网络连接稳定。

    2. 数据库服务器问题:数据库服务器可能发生故障或出现问题,导致数据库断开连接。这可能是由于硬件故障、数据库崩溃、数据库服务停止等原因导致的。在这种情况下,需要检查数据库服务器的状态,并采取相应的措施来修复问题。

    3. 客户端问题:应用程序或客户端可能存在问题,导致无法与数据库建立或保持连接。这可能是由于错误的数据库配置、连接字符串错误、应用程序错误等原因导致的。在这种情况下,需要检查客户端的设置和配置,并确保其与数据库服务器的连接正常。

    4. 长时间空闲:如果数据库连接在一段时间内没有活动,则可能会被数据库服务器主动断开。这是为了节省资源和提高性能。在这种情况下,需要在应用程序中实现合适的连接池管理,以确保数据库连接保持活动状态。

    5. 安全设置:数据库服务器的安全设置可能会导致数据库连接被拒绝或中断。这可能是由于访问控制列表(ACL)或防火墙设置限制了对数据库的访问。在这种情况下,需要检查数据库服务器的安全设置,并确保应用程序具有足够的权限来连接数据库。

    总结:当说SQL数据库已断开时,可能是由于网络问题、数据库服务器问题、客户端问题、长时间空闲或安全设置等原因导致的。为了解决这个问题,需要检查并修复相关的原因,并确保数据库与应用程序之间的连接正常。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    当说一个SQL数据库已断开,意味着数据库连接被意外中断或关闭。这可能是由于各种原因导致的,如网络问题、服务器故障、数据库服务停止运行等。

    当数据库连接断开时,应用程序将无法与数据库通信,无法执行任何SQL查询或更新操作。这将导致应用程序无法访问数据库中的数据,从而可能导致应用程序出现错误或无法正常工作。

    当数据库连接断开时,应该采取以下措施来解决问题:

    1. 检查网络连接:首先,确保网络连接正常,数据库服务器可以通过网络访问。可以尝试使用其他网络工具测试与数据库服务器的连接,如ping命令。

    2. 检查数据库服务器状态:确认数据库服务器是否正常运行。可以尝试重新启动数据库服务,或者检查数据库服务的日志文件以查看是否有任何错误信息。

    3. 检查数据库连接设置:检查应用程序中的数据库连接设置,确保连接字符串、用户名和密码等参数正确配置。可能需要更新连接字符串或更改用户名和密码。

    4. 重启应用程序:如果以上步骤都没有解决问题,可以尝试重新启动应用程序,以便重新建立与数据库的连接。

    5. 联系数据库管理员:如果问题仍然存在,可能需要联系数据库管理员或技术支持人员寻求帮助。他们可以提供更详细的故障排除步骤或修复措施。

    总结来说,当SQL数据库断开连接时,需要检查网络连接、数据库服务器状态、数据库连接设置,并尝试重新启动应用程序。如果问题仍然存在,可以寻求数据库管理员或技术支持的帮助。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    当说一个SQL数据库已经断开,意味着与该数据库的连接已经中断。这可能是由于多种原因导致的,包括网络问题、数据库服务器故障、连接超时等。

    当数据库断开连接时,无法进行任何与数据库相关的操作。这意味着无法执行查询、插入、更新或删除数据等操作。如果正在执行事务,则可能会导致事务失败并回滚。

    在应用程序中,如果连接到数据库的链接断开,通常会抛出一个异常。这时,应用程序需要重新建立与数据库的连接,以便恢复正常的数据库操作。

    以下是一些常见的原因和解决方法,当数据库断开连接时:

    1. 网络问题:可能是由于网络中断、网络延迟或防火墙阻止了与数据库服务器的连接。解决方法是检查网络连接是否正常,确保网络稳定,并确保防火墙允许与数据库服务器的通信。

    2. 数据库服务器故障:数据库服务器可能发生故障或重启。在这种情况下,需要等待数据库服务器恢复正常。可以尝试重新连接数据库,如果仍然无法连接,则需要联系数据库管理员进行故障排除。

    3. 连接超时:如果连接到数据库的时间超过了预设的超时时间,连接可能会被自动关闭。解决方法是增加连接超时时间,或者在应用程序中实现自动重连机制。

    4. 数据库连接池问题:如果应用程序使用连接池管理数据库连接,连接池可能出现故障或连接耗尽。解决方法是检查连接池配置,确保连接池设置合理,并确保连接池正常工作。

    5. 错误的连接参数:如果连接参数(如数据库名称、用户名、密码)不正确,连接将无法建立。解决方法是检查连接参数是否正确,并修改为正确的参数。

    总之,当SQL数据库断开连接时,需要检查网络连接、数据库服务器状态、连接超时设置、连接池配置和连接参数等方面,以确定断开连接的原因,并采取相应的解决方法来恢复数据库连接。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部